qcacmn: Do not call stats_cb after vdev is deleted

Currently before calling the stats_cbk we do not
check if the vdev has been deleted or not. There is
a case where vdev might be deleted (but not freed due
to pending ref-count) and the osif_vdev will be freed
as a part of the delete sequence. In this case, calling
stats_cbk with dangling pointer to osif_vdev will lead
to an access to memory which has been freed.

To mitigate this issue, check if the vdev has been marked
for deletion, before calling the stats_cbk in tx completion
path.
